Living in Sheffield and looking to earn without prior experience? There are multiple opportunities that don’t require a background in a specific field. These roles are ideal for students, career changers, or anyone needing a flexible income source.

Common types of beginner-friendly positions available in Sheffield include:

  • Retail assistant roles in local supermarkets and high street stores
  • Warehouse pickers and packers at regional distribution centers
  • Food delivery drivers and riders for platforms like Just Eat or Deliveroo
  • Bar staff and waiters in pubs, cafés, and restaurants

Note: Most of these jobs provide on-the-job training and offer hourly pay with flexible shifts.

Steps to get started with one of these jobs:

  1. Prepare a simple CV highlighting your soft skills (e.g. communication, punctuality)
  2. Search local job boards such as Indeed, Reed, or local Facebook groups
  3. Apply directly or visit the location to ask about open vacancies

Here’s a comparison of popular roles and their average hourly rates in Sheffield:

Job Type Average Hourly Pay Typical Schedule
Retail Assistant £9.50 - £10.50 Evenings & Weekends
Warehouse Operative £10.00 - £11.50 Night Shifts Available
Delivery Driver £11.00 - £13.00 Flexible Hours
